Introducing Node Management Platform 2.0

Rangers Protocol’s Node Management Platform 2.0 is a one-stop solution for all user needs in node services and portfolio management. It offers node purchase and rental services and real-time data to assist users in becoming verification nodes and enjoying affordable and effortless mining.

Besides simplifying the process for users to become verification nodes, this major update introduces powerful features such as the Delegated Staking System. Such an upgrade is a testament to Rangers Protocol’s commitment to fostering an efficient and inclusive blockchain ecosystem.

Main Features

Wallet Account Management & Top Up: Users can easily register or log in using their email address, top up their hot wallets, and review their top-up history.

Aggregated Application Processes: Node server purchasing, validator application, and mine owner application are now consolidated under one dashboard, offering users greater flexibility and ease of navigation.

Validator Center for Delegated Staking: Users can view, add, and look up all active validator nodes under the Validator Center, and review information about delegators, stakings, and rewards.

Delegated Staking System: This integrated system enables ecosystem nodes to open for delegations and benefit from customized commissions, while mass investors can delegate their RPG tokens to preferred nodes and enjoy distributed rewards.

Node Hosting Management: Users can review and modify their nodes and delegate under the Portfolio tab, including real-time node data on the Rangers Protocol decentralized network.

Data Interface: Users can view ecosystem nodes, monitor earnings, and gain quantitative insight into node performances with the Calculator feature.

Hardware services can be purchased directly from the platform, so hardware configuration is no longer a hassle. More aggregated than ever, all the essential features are just one click away from each other. Streamlined application process block making it easier for inexperienced users to navigate, lowering the threshold of joining the Rangers Protocol verification network. The platform offers free membership and monthly node rentals at a reasonable price of 300 $USDT.

About Rangers Protocol

Rangers Protocol is the backbone of a Web3 engine for creating immersive Web3 applications. It minimizes the development difficulty for Web3 developers and maximizes the user experience of its Web3 applications. Rangers Protocol provides comprehensive infrastructures for efficient complex-app development, successful cross-chain and mass distribution, diverse in-app NFT and DeFi features, and more. Through its full EVM compatibility, strategic industry partnerships, and curated all-in-one IDE, Rangers Protocol supports AAA and indie developers to succeed in the Web3 world.
